Leadbeater's Addresses During The War is a book written by C.W. Leadbeater that contains a collection of speeches and addresses delivered by the author during World War I. The book provides a unique perspective on the war and the events leading up to it, as seen through the eyes of a prominent Theosophist and spiritual teacher. Leadbeater's speeches cover a wide range of topics, including the causes and effects of the war, the role of spirituality in times of conflict, and the importance of peace and unity among nations.
